Turbo diesels can have twice the power below 3000rpm compared to an equivalent naturally aspirated petrol

Turbo diesels can have twice the power below 3000rpm compared to an equivalent naturally aspirated petrol. So the TD will be faster in 90% of driving conditions even if the max bhp is less and the 0-60 and top speed are slower.

Why is my car dieseling?

“Don’t take life so serious, you won’t get out alive…” Dieseling is usually caused by a lean idle mixture or a spark plug that’s getting really hot. Make sure you don’t have any vacuum leaks and recheck the idle mixture. Turn the idle down as far as you can when adjusting.

How much fuel can you save by driving smoothly?

Slow down Your fuel costs will increase the faster you drive, so keep speeds reasonable. According to government stats, driving at a steady speed of 50 miles per hour (mph) instead of 70mph can improve fuel economy by 25%. That said, obviously, you should drive at speeds appropriate to the road you are on.

How to improve gas mileage in Canada?

Increasing your highway cruising speed from 55mph (90km/h) to 75mph (120km/h) can raise fuel consumption as much as 20%. You can improve your gas mileage 10 – 15% by driving at 55mph rather than 65mph (104km/h). Natural Resources Canada puts the “sweet spot” for most cars, trucks, and SUVs even lower, between 30 mph (50 km/h) and 50 mph (80 km/h).

What is the efficiency of a diesel engine?

Theoretically, the highest possible efficiency for a diesel engine is 75%. However, in practice the efficiency is much lower, with efficiencies of up to 43% for passenger car engines, up to 45% for large truck and bus engines, and up to 55% for large two-stroke marine engines.

What is the best speed for fuel efficiency?

According to the US Department of Energy, cars get the best mileage (i. e. the optimal fuel efficiency) between 40 and 55 mph. Additionally, at higher speeds, air resistance and drag become more pronounced and cause vehicles to consume more fuel.

What is a medium speed diesel engine?

Medium-speed engines are used in large electrical generators, railway diesel locomotives, ship propulsion and mechanical drive applications such as large compressors or pumps. Medium speed diesel engines operate on either diesel fuel or heavy fuel oil by direct injection in the same manner as low-speed engines.

Which fuel has more energy – petrol or diesel?

In pure scientific terms, diesel fuel has more energy by volume than petrol (36.9 megajoules per litre vs 33.7 megajoules per litre). By its nature, petrol is a lighter fuel that evaporates into the air more readily than diesel, while diesel is a denser fuel that is not easily ignited.

What is the calorific value of diesel fuel?

The calorific value of diesel fuel is roughly 45.5 MJ/kg (megajoules per kilogram), slightly lower than petrol which is 45.8 MJ/kg. However, diesel fuel is denser than petrol and contains about 15% more energy by volume (roughly 36.9 MJ/litre compared to 33.7 MJ/litre).

Why are diesel cars more expensive than petrol cars?

Diesel cars are typically more expensive to buy because their engines often require extra hardware compared to petrol vehicles. What are the advantages of a diesel engine?

Diesel engines have much larger crankshafts, camshafts, and cylinders, as well as larger bearing sizes. This means that there is more room within the engine for more oil to move freely. The larger oil and coolant capacity of a diesel engine means there is better lubrication and less wear.

Is a diesel engine a heavy duty engine?

You can say that diesel engines are “heavy duty” engines and, moreover, they are the more efficient type, compared to gasoline engines. This is why diesel engines are used in every large truck, non-electric train, most naval vessels and nearly all industrial scale AC generator systems.
